We heard great things about this place so we decided to try it out for lunch. The place opens at 11:30am and we got there around 11:15am and there was already a long line of people waiting. They do not take reservations for lunch during the week so we put our name on the waiting list. We were about 10th on the waiting list and was told it would take anywhere from 30-60mins before a table would be available. However, you can sit at the bar. We decided to sit at the bar but was told we could not order any combos, lunch specials, hot food. Those things are only available if you sit at a table which sucked. We didn't want to wait so we sat at the bar. The sushi was pretty good, not the best I've had but better than most places. I noticed our chef was pretty quiet and didn't engage in too much conversation while the other chefs were yapping in up with the customers they were helping. The pricing is expensive but that's sushi for you. I always spend about $50-$60 on myself and want to go and get a burger afterwards cause I'm still hungry. Service was good and food decent. I didn't care for the pricing/food quantity ratio, lack of seating and most importantly, no reservations during the week for lunch. I'll stick to AYCE sushi places. The quality might not be as good but at least I'm full for less than $40.
